Transaction eebba4e53f86ddeb7fbb88f55ad8a9fb6055ced8f418373746b69a72088d75f1
1 Input
1 Output
-
eebba4e53f86ddeb7fbb88f55ad8a9fb6055ced8f418373746b69a72088d75f1:0
- value
- 697236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96cbb16f48c9d725ad19c2b919ff3cca96369748 OP_EQUAL
- address
- 3FSMJARfTKiAU8nVZGFHvxpGhyTPEeqgMc